Generates entity ID and connects with Vault (secret engine) to retrieve credentials
Project description
common
Importable package responsible for cross-service tasks within the Pilot Platform (e.g. logging, Vault connection, etc.).
Getting Started
Installation & Quick Start
The latest version of the common package is available on PyPi and can be installed into another service via Pip.
Pip install from PyPi:
pip install pilot-platform-common
In pyproject.toml
:
pilot-platform-common = "^<VERSION>"
Pip install from a local .whl
file:
pip install pilot_platform_common-<VERSION>-py3-none-any.whl
Contribution
You can contribute the project in following ways:
- Report a bug.
- Suggest a feature.
- Open a pull request for fixing issues or adding functionality. Please consider using pre-commit in this case.
- For general guidelines on how to contribute to the project, please take a look at the contribution guide.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for pilot-platform-common-0.5.5.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| a59863f106bbab524e3f7f8f4edf43f5471a04204a183b4440bde33ed5a5c533 |
|
MD5 | 263d4ab180e04706f9a78a0daab8757d |
|
BLAKE2b-256 | 7331eb357aaf05e2b69cd2b2bd6d89d7e3a7867bb241fd4b1fb6ea425e72eb9d |
Close
Hashes for pilot_platform_common-0.5.5-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| de8b234d366995799d8ae20bf0f0d4c9c7bf2847477493f657a9dcab78ef59bf |
|
MD5 | f9be2099f971c6877df7c23afb32dd91 |
|
BLAKE2b-256 | d5c88b09029827540e852d751a578ef31da9ca5b4ba4d2b0260547a8458e0757 |